This is the Wiki Home for the Enterprise Integration Diagram Editor project. This project is a simple editor for the construction of Enterprise Integration Patterns as described by Hohpe and Wolff in their book. The editor comes with a pluggable framework for the generation of code or configurations based upon the underlying EMF model. There are three examples of configuration generators - one for PeTaLs, one for Apache ServiceMix (these are both JBI-compliant ESBs) and one for Apache Camel. These examples are exactly that, and are not functionally complete. |
